NBA 2K26 comes close to perfection, yet presents a significant shortcoming
NBA 2K26, the latest instalment in the popular basketball series, has arrived with a host of exciting new features that promise to revolutionise the gaming experience.
One of the standout additions is the revamped MyPLAYER Builder. Players can now build their characters by badges, shaping the framework of their player, and there's a new scouting report feature to help understand the build created. A new animation glossary has been introduced to provide more detail about different player builds, offering a deeper level of customisation from the start.
The gameplay in NBA 2K26 features Play Now options for both the NBA and WNBA, and a streamlined MyTEAM mode. WNBA has been fully integrated into MyTEAM for the first time, and 2v2 games have been introduced.
New machine learning technology in NBA 2K26 provides more precise, lifelike movement with 'skating' effects removed. The ProPLAY motion engine, generated from real-world NBA footage, influences all movement on the court. New shaders and lighting technology have been used to enhance the look of the court, adding more life and sheen.
Enhanced rhythm shooting in NBA 2K26 manipulates the shooter's upper body and affects the shot's appearance based on shot timing and tempo. Green or miss shot timing is now universal across all modes, with higher difficulty requiring more precise shot timing to score.
However, there seems to be an issue with the balance of player roles in the All-Star Team-Up games. A towering center build appears to be overpowered compared to other roles. Blocking shots in these games is relatively easy, particularly for taller players, even when shots are well-timed.
Nikola Jokic is being highlighted in NBA 2K26 for his post playmaking abilities, with the developers emphasising that being a center in the game is a lot of fun. Gameplay in NBA 2K26 has undergone significant changes, making it more skill-based and faster.
Overall, NBA 2K26 feels more fluid, fresh, faster, and fun compared to its predecessor. With its improved visuals, integrated WNBA, and streamlined gameplay, it's shaping up to be a game that basketball fans won't want to miss.
